In this comprehensive course on algorithmic trading, you will learn about three cutting-edge trading strategies to enhance your financial toolkit. In the first module, you'll explore the Unsupervised Learning Trading Strategy, utilizing Su0026P 500 stocks data to master features, indicators, and portfolio optimization.

Next, you'll leverage the power of social media with the Twitter Sentiment Investing Strategy, ranking NASDAQ stocks based on engagement and evaluating performance against the QQQ return. Lastly, the Intraday Strategy will introduce you to the GARCH model, combining it with technical indicators to capture both daily and intraday signals for potential lucrative positions.
